GUEST BIO
One of the music industry's most influential figures, Miles Copeland's career in management stretches back 44 years to 1969 in London where he represented progressive rock bands such as Wishbone Ash, Al Stewart, Climax Blues Band, Renaissance, Curved Air, and Caravan until he jumped ship, landed in the turbulent ocean of punk, and worked with the Sex Pistols, the Clash, Blondie, and many many more. In 1978, he became manager of his Brother Stewart's band, The Police and shepherded them to become one of the biggest bands of the 1980s.
